The Shure SFG-2 Stylus Tracking Force Gauge is the industry standard. This simple-to-use measuring device was developed to give listeners a way to insure against the problems caused by improper tracking force settings, which include mistracking, excessive record and tip wear, and poor sound reproduction.

This gauge is a highly accurate beam balance instrument designed to measure the actual downward force exerted by a stylus on a record over the range of 0.5 to 3.0 grams. Each gauge is individually factory calibrated, and displays readings in 0.05 gram increments in order to provide a precise measurement of stylus tracking force.

Shure SFG-2 Features:
Accuracy to within 1/10 of a gram in primary operating range (1/2 to 1-1/2 grams).
Extended force measurement rage (1 to 3 grams).
Fiction-free precision stainless steel pivot joints.
Easy-to-read reference bars for perfect balance and absolute accuracy.
Tracking force is measured with tone arm in actual playing position.
